Meaning of Performance Benchmarking

To benchmark your performance, you compare your performance metrics to those of your competitors or to known best practices in your field. It has to do with knowing where you stand in relation to other people in your field. This could include a lot of different things, such how well the business is doing financially and how well it runs. The purpose is to find areas that could be improved and set realistic goals for the future. It’s like having a fitness tracker that keeps an eye on your work or business performance. You check, rate, and improve.

What are Some Common Mistakes in Performance Benchmarking?

Common mistakes include comparing things that are not the same, misanalyzing data, and putting too much weight on outside comparisons. It is important to make sure that you are comparing the same measurements and understanding the data correctly. Also, remember that benchmarking is just one tool in your toolbox; you shouldn’t use it as the only thing to make decisions.
